Model Wife is a web series created, written and produced by Corey Cavin, Josh Lay, and Bill Grandberg. The series is broadcast on the Internet and premiered on March 27, 2012. So far, 10 episodes have been made and the show can be found distributed across the web including on YouTube and Blip. The series was nominated for a Writers Guild of America award in January 2013 for Outstanding Achievement in Writing Original New Media.

The main characters of Model Wife are a normal guy, his supermodel wife, and their two neighbors. The plot revolves around blogger Corey, who manages to marry a supermodel. Each episode sees Corey get into situations and having to deal with dilemmas arising from having a supermodel for a girlfriend. Cavin is a comedian, writer, and actor living in New York City, often performing at the UCB Theatre in New York and working for Nikki & Sara LIVE on MTV. Lay is also a comedian, writer, and actor living in New York City, with work including as a cast member and teaching artist for the nationally recognized children's entertainment ensemble Story Pirates.
